diff --git a/doc/news.txt b/doc/news.txt index 6946a16bc1..b809d54374 100644 --- a/doc/news.txt +++ b/doc/news.txt @@ -4,6 +4,43 @@ =========== +Genode SoC porting guide | 2022-05-25 +##################################### + +| In the second revision of the Genode Platform document, Genode Labs shares +| its former in-house expertise about moving Genode to new hardware devices. + +If you ever wondered how to make sense of highly-complex ARM SoCs without +accurate public documentation, what it takes to bring a modern microkernel +from one SoC to another, how to transplant and re-animate individual Linux +kernel subsystems into sandboxed user-level components, or how to craft a +custom bare-bones operating system out of Genode's components, the new +revision of the Genode Platforms document is for you. + +[https://genode.org/documentation/genode-platforms-22-05.pdf - Genode Platforms 22.05] (PDF) + +During the past two years, Genode developer Norman Feske captured his +practical experience with enabling Genode on a new hardware platform, namely +the PinePhone. + +The process starts with basics like executing tiny bits of custom code, and +continues with the porting of the microkernel, creating work flows for testing +and packaging, and bringing up the Genode user land. + +With those fundamentals covered, the main part is concerned with the +complexities of driving the device hardware of modern SoCs, ranging from +low-level pin controls, over networking, up to driving sophisticated devices +like the display and touch screen. For the latter, the ability of reusing +device drivers from the Linux kernel plays a crucial role. Hence, the guide +presents Genode's practical methodology and tooling behind the black art of +transplanting and reanimating unmodified Linux kernel code into Genode +components. Along the way, there are countless little tips and tricks that +help to turn low-level grunt work into a fun and worthwhile experience. + +The document closes with a glimpse at real-world scenarios, culminating in +the setup the modem and the routing of audio signals to issue voice calls. + + Sculpt OS release 22.04 | 2022-04-28 ####################################
